The Convergence of Ecosystems: Why Android on Laptops Is More Than a Trend
The idea of running Android on a laptop isn’t new. Google first introduced Android apps on ChromeOS in 2016, and since then, millions of users have accessed mobile apps on larger screens. But Googlebook represents a fundamental evolution—it’s not just about running apps; it’s about creating an optimized experience where the laptop becomes a natural extension of the Android ecosystem. This means deep integration with Google services like Drive, Photos, Meet, and Assistant, as well as access to the full suite of Android apps—from creative tools like Canva and Adobe Scan to productivity apps like Notion and Trello.
What sets Googlebook apart is its focus on AI-first design. Unlike traditional laptops that rely on local processing power, Googlebook devices are engineered to offload heavy computation to the cloud. This allows for thinner, lighter designs without sacrificing performance. For instance, Google’s Tensor Processing Units (TPUs) and cloud-based AI models can handle tasks like real-time language translation, smart summarization of documents, or even AI-assisted coding—features that were once the domain of high-end desktops.

Design Meets Intelligence: The Aesthetic and Functional Evolution of Laptops
Rumors and early leaks about Lenovo’s Googlebook lineup reveal a design philosophy that merges minimalism with technological flair. The devices are said to feature a sleek, all-white chassis with subtle Lenovo branding and a distinctive visual element: a Pixel Glow Bar—a thin LED strip near the top edge that illuminates in response to user activity. This isn’t just for show; it’s a functional UI element that can indicate system status, notifications, or even serve as a visual cue during video calls.
But the real innovation lies beneath the surface. Googlebook laptops are expected to leverage Lenovo’s Yoga form factor—convertible 2-in-1 designs with 360-degree hinges, touchscreens, and stylus support. This versatility is crucial in markets like Northeast India, where users often juggle multiple roles: a student taking notes, a freelancer sketching designs, a healthcare worker updating digital records. The ability to switch between laptop, tablet, and tent modes ensures adaptability in diverse use cases.
Hardware specifications are also noteworthy. Early reports suggest configurations powered by Qualcomm’s Snapdragon 8cx Gen 3 or MediaTek’s Kompanio processors—mobile-grade chips that deliver laptop-class performance while maintaining exceptional battery life. Some models may include 13-inch or 14-inch 120Hz OLED displays, a feature rarely seen in budget laptops but increasingly common in premium Android tablets. With up to 16GB of RAM and 512GB of UFS storage, these devices are designed to handle multitasking, media editing, and even light gaming without overheating or draining the battery.

The Broader Implications: Can Googlebook Challenge the Laptop Duopoly?
To understand the significance of Googlebook, we must examine the broader computing landscape. For decades, Microsoft Windows and Apple’s macOS have dominated the laptop market, with a combined share of over 90%. ChromeOS, while growing, has remained a niche player, primarily due to its reliance on web apps and limited offline functionality. Googlebook aims to change that by combining the best of both worlds: the familiarity and app ecosystem of Android with the productivity and portability of a laptop.
This is a high-stakes gamble. Google has attempted to disrupt the laptop market before—most notably with the Chromebook Pixel in 2013, a premium device that failed to gain traction due to its high price and limited app support. But times have changed. Today, Android boasts over 3.5 million apps, cloud computing is ubiquitous, and AI is transforming how we work. Googlebook is not just another Chromebook—it’s a platform designed for the post-PC era, where the line between phone, tablet, and laptop is increasingly blurred.
For Lenovo, the partnership with Google is a strategic masterstroke. The company has long been the world’s largest PC vendor, but it has struggled to differentiate itself in a crowded market dominated by HP, Dell, and Apple. By aligning with Google’s vision, Lenovo gains access to a vast ecosystem of users, developers, and cloud services. It also positions itself as a leader in the emerging market for AI-first devices—a category that could redefine the entire tech industry.
Yet, challenges remain. Battery life, a perennial issue with Android laptops, must improve. App optimization for larger screens is still inconsistent, and many users are hesitant to switch from Windows or macOS due to familiarity. Googlebook will need to prove that it can deliver a seamless, lag-free experience—especially when running demanding apps or multitasking.
